    THE IMPACT OF LOGISTICS PERFORMANCE ON THE SALES LEVEL An Empirical Study in Retail Sector

    Get PDF
    The aim of this research is to assess the impact of logistics performance on retail sector. This research was conducted in Palu in Central Sulawesi Province. There are several indicators involve in this study, such as, customer service, operation metric, and logistics cost. This research is categorized as explanatory research and multiple regression method was used to analyze the hypotheses. Simultaneously, this research found that logistics performance has significant contribution to sales level. However, customer service has not had positive contribution to sales level compare to operation metric and logistics cost. In addition, logistics cost has big impact on the sales level of retail groceries. The result of this research can be used by academicians and professionals who intent to deal with logistics in retail sector. This research also identifies that logistics performance need further study in different region and sector with the aim to improve the understanding of dimension

    Analisa Hukum Terhadap Perjanjian Kerjasama Pengelolaan Pas Masuk Terminal Penumpang Dalam Negeri di Pelabuhan Sri Bintan Pura Tanjung Pinang

    Get PDF
    The purpose of granting regional autonomy is to empower the region in the form of improving care, protection, welfare, initiative, creativity, and community participation in development, foster democracy, equity and justice, and unity, unity, and national harmony in the remembrance of the origin of an area, diversity and characteristics, as well as potential areas that lead to the improvement of the welfare of the people in the system of the Republic of Indonesia. In that regard, it has been made Cooperation Agreement between PT. (Persero) IPC I Branch Tanjung Pinang Tanjung Pinang with the City Government B.XIV-1/TPI-US.15 Numbers and Number 552.3/091.A/HUBLA signed on March 15, 2011 on the Management of Pas Log of Domestic Passenger Terminal in port of Sri Bintan Pura Tanjung Pinang. Examined in this study are some of the regulations that form the basis of law in the cooperation agreement which according to the author it is important to study whether the regulation is used as a legal basis in the agreement is appropriate or not. Also on the principles and factors that must be considered in the drafting of the contract. Methods The approach used in this study is normative methods. From these results it can be concluded that in principle any drafting the contract is to be an agreement of the parties ranging from the use of the term contract until the dispute settlement while referring to the legislation in force, is not contrary to public order and decency. Factors that must be considered by the parties and will hold the legal authority to make the contract are the parties, taxation, over a legal right, the problem keagrarian, choice of law, dispute resolution, termination of contract, and the agreed standard form of agreement. That the legal basis used by PT. IPC I (Persero) Branch Tanjung Pinang in the partnership agreement is in conformity with the applicable regulations. That the legal basis used by the Local Government Tanjungpinang in the partnership agreement does not conform and contrary to regulations. Keywords: Regional Autonomy, Ports and Cooperation Agreement

    Ketersediaan Sarana Angkutan Bagi Pekerja Penyandang Disabilitas di Jawa dan Bali

    Get PDF
    Penelitian ini menggunakan pendekatan kuantitatif dan kualitatif. Lokasi penelitian berada pada enam provinsi di Indonesia yakni Provinsi Jawa Timur, Jawa Barat, Jawa Tengah, Bali, DKI Jakarta dan D.I. Yogyakarta. Sampel dalam penelitian ini sebanyak 71 perusahaan bisnis yang mempekerjakan penyandang disabilitas. Perusahaan yang menyediakan sarana angkutan bagi pekerja penyandang disabilitas sebanyak lima perusahaan (7,04 %), sedangkan sisanya sebanyak 66 perusahaan (92,06 %) tidak menyediakan sarana angkutan bagi pekerja penyandang disabilitas. Dengan menggunakan uji parsial pada regresi logistik, dapat diketahui bahwa diantara delapan variabel ketenagakerjaan yang diuji, hanya variabel X3 (Jumlah Seluruh Pekerja di Perusahaan) dan X8 (Perusahaan Membutuhkan Insentif Dengan Mempekerjakan Pekerja Disabilitas) yang signifikan dengan taraf α = 0.10. Bila dilihat dari korelasinya, kedua variabel X3 dan X8 memiliki korelasi positif terhadap ketersediaan sarana angkutan bagi pekerja penyandang disabilitas

    Challenges and Opportunities for Community Empowerment in The Era of Society 5.0

    Get PDF
    Society 5.0 is a technology-based human-centered society concept. In this case, there has been rapid technological development, including human roles being replaced by intelligent robots. Artificial intelligence will transform millions of data collected through the internet in all areas of life through Society 5.0. It is to increase human capacity in opening up opportunities for humanity. This article was qualitative research with a literature review method to assist a researcher in providing an overview of the context of or current issues. Research data sources were journals, articles, books, and other relevant references. Data collection techniques were carried out by using literature study and documentation. The data analysis technique began with accessing the data, organizing, sorting, categorizing, and classifying the collected documentation studies. Various problems arose in the Era of Society as an extraordinary challenge in preparing the existing human resources. If human resources were fulfilled, then the various opportunities for sustainable advancement of IT would be more easily felt by the community so that they could face humans to live, grow, and prosper through collaboration between machines and co-creation. Therefore, it was necessary to strengthen community empowerment through cooperation between elements, including government, non-governmental organizations, political parties, community organizations, and educational institutions, as provisions for the development process in facing the challenges of entering Society 5.0
